Grading Criteria

Points Possible: 8

  • Wireframe: Wireframe is in black and white, contains actual text where appropriate, and does not include images. Demonstrates a thoughtful and meaningful consideration of the user experience. The finished design is consistent, polished, and realistic, with enough detail to indicate the purpose of each user interface element. (4 pts)

  • Feedback: Demonstrates analysis of group members' wireframes; provides helpful suggestions on how to improve the design and supports group members with valuable feedback in the form of "I like..., because", "I wish..., because", and "I wonder..., because" statements have been used. (4 pts)
